Output 3de9741bd284f83e5731a9e32eb29358746f4effef7acff6e2c1220d85061c90:0

value
25672331
script pubkey
OP_HASH160 OP_PUSHBYTES_20 15e3e2010b43371c5ee103a02bf66dd792ab13ab OP_EQUAL
address
M9tuR2zRS4fDBbxCZbyGnNAD34mN5rwHtD
transaction
3de9741bd284f83e5731a9e32eb29358746f4effef7acff6e2c1220d85061c90
spent
true